Cunibert (Hunibert, or Chunebert), Bishop of Cologne

in the 7th century, was born in the bishopric of Trier, He was made bishop in 623, and died in 663. He took an active part in the religious and political affairs of his time. Under Sigebert III and Childeric II he exercised a great influence. See Gallia Christiana, 3; Gelenius, De Adm. Afagnitudine Coloniae (Cologne, 1645); Rettberg, Kirchengeschichte Deutschlands, 1:296; Hefele, in Wetzer u. Welte's Kirchen-Lexikon; Wagsnmann, in Herzog's Real-Encyclop. s.v. He is set down as a saint in Usuard's Martyrology, November 12. (B.P.)
